Transaction 840ef830117c743cf5df19fb56340add5817899fc744b70990467dc9081fcc48
1 Input
1 Output
-
840ef830117c743cf5df19fb56340add5817899fc744b70990467dc9081fcc48:0
- value
- 3647877
- script pubkey
- OP_0 OP_PUSHBYTES_20 859b012f012d5741364791d47e82ab7e67439d82
- address
- bc1qskdsztcp94t5zdj8j828aq4t0en588vzeh52f0